The other thing that stuck out to me was this:
According to figures from Sparks, UW spent $7.5 million on football in 2014-15.
Football generated $10.9 million, but Sparks said after “subtracting game management operational expenses related to football,” the sport generated $2.6 million.

That is confusing. Does this mean that total costs for football were $7.5 million and revenue was $10.9 million for a profit of $3.4 million? Does it mean that profit is $3.4 million but there is an additional $800K in expenditures that aren't included in the $7.5 million so the actual profit is $2.6 million? Does it mean that football generated $10.9 million but game management cost $8.3 million (not counted in $7.5 million) so total revenue is actually $2.6 million - $7.5 million in expenses = football loses $4.9 million?

I don't understand that comment. Any ideas?
